At the end of her bestselling memoir Eat, Pray, Love, Elizabeth Gilbert fell in love with Felipe -

a Brazilian-born man of Australian citizenship who'd been living in Indonesia when they met.

Resettling in America, the couple swore eternal fidelity to each other, but also swore to

never, ever, under any circumstances get legally married. (Both survivors of difficult divorces.

Enough said.) But providence intervened one day in the form of the U.S. government, who -

after unexpectedly detaining Felipe at an American border crossing - gave the couple a

choice: they could either get married, or Felipe would never be allowed to enter the country

again.

Having been effectively sentenced to wed, Gilbert tackled her fears of marriage by delving

completely into this topic, trying with all her might to discover (through historical research,

interviews and much personal reflection) what this stubbornly enduring old institution actually

is. The result is Committed - a witty and intelligent contemplation of marriage that debunks

myths, unthreads fears and suggests that sometimes even the most romantic of souls must

trade in her amorous fantasies for the humbling responsibility of adulthood. Gilbert's

memoir - destined to become a cherished handbook for any thinking person hovering on the

verge of marriage - is ultimately a clear-eyed celebration of love, with all the complexity and

consequence that real love, in the real world, actually entails.

這本果然講的是大問題 - 婚姻。與第一本不同,這不再是關於一個人的故事,而是兩個人如何剋服對婚姻的恐懼。結婚就如同一個枷鎖,特彆是對那些沒有安全感的人來說,很多人擔心會讓人失去自我,最後雖然夫妻一場但已經沒有感情,隻有各種妥協下的相處。說到這,如此現實的問題不禁讓還沒結婚人們唏噓不已。而已經在圍城裏的人們會以各種自身經曆教導我們不要盲目的相信愛情和婚姻可以共存。好萊塢式的童話永遠隻存在於電影裏,而我們注定要在不完美中找尋自己對婚姻的答案。

喜歡eatpreylove的這本就不用讀瞭。比Oneday也差得很遠很遠啊!有關marriage半生不熟的說教很悶,似乎是熬瞭好幾夜還寫壞瞭的學生paper--清晨發現問題齣在topic選錯上,卻隻能打著哈欠草草交差瞭。個人恐婚的情緒把整體故事搞得更加支離破碎。讀後發現男主角真的是個人物,落墨放在他身上會好看很多,再或者就單純寫個美利堅被婚奇遇也會有趣。liz,聘我當總策劃吧,保證大賣! 2011年11月26日周六讀完最後幾頁。
